Understanding Sensory Processing Disorder and How It Affects Your Child

Sensory processing disorder (SPD) occurs when the nervous system struggles to receive, organize, and respond to sensory input from the environment. Children with sensory processing issues may become overwhelmed by everyday sensations like clothing textures, loud noises, or busy environments. Others seek intense sensory input through constant movement or touch.

This processing disorder affects many children and can significantly impact learning, behavior, and social development. The nervous system acts as your child’s command center, receiving sensory information through sight, sound, touch, taste, smell, movement, and body position. When neural pathways function optimally, the brain processes this sensory input smoothly, allowing appropriate responses.

Sensory Overresponsivity Signs

Children who are overresponsive to sensory input may avoid certain textures, refuse specific clothing, or become distressed by loud noises. They might resist hair brushing, teeth brushing, or nail trimming due to overwhelming sensory experiences. These children often struggle in busy environments like classrooms, birthday parties, or grocery stores where multiple sensory inputs create distress.

Sensory Underresponsivity Signs

Some children with sensory processing issues appear underresponsive, seeming unaware of pain, temperature changes, or when others touch them. They may not notice messy faces or hands, bump into furniture frequently, or struggle with body awareness during activities. These children need more intense sensory input to register sensations that other children notice easily.

Sensory Seeking Behaviors

Children who constantly seek sensory input may touch everything, struggle to sit still, or engage in rough play that seems excessive. They might chew on non-food items, crash into furniture deliberately, or need constant movement throughout the day. This sensory seeking reflects their nervous system’s attempt to receive adequate sensory information for proper function and regulation.

Understanding the Role of Sensory Diet and Activities

A sensory diet refers to the planned activities an occupational therapist designs to provide appropriate sensory input throughout your child’s day. These activities might include movement breaks, heavy work tasks, tactile experiences, or calming strategies tailored to your child’s specific sensory needs. The sensory diet helps children maintain optimal arousal levels for learning and appropriate behavior.
